Skip to main content

SpaceMembershipClient

@tribeplatform/gql-client / Modules / clients / SpaceMembershipClient

Class: SpaceMembershipClient#

clients.SpaceMembershipClient

Table of contents#

Constructors#

Methods#

Constructors#

constructor#

new SpaceMembershipClient(client)

Parameters#

NameType
clientGraphqlClient

Defined in#

packages/client/src/clients/spaceMembership.client.ts:24

Methods#

approveRequest#

approveRequest(variables, fields?, accessToken?): Promise<Action>

Parameters#

NameTypeDefault value
variablesMutationApproveSpaceMembershipRequestArgsundefined
fieldsActionFields'basic'
accessToken?stringundefined

Returns#

Promise<Action>

Defined in#

packages/client/src/clients/spaceMembership.client.ts:70


declineRequest#

declineRequest(variables, fields?, accessToken?): Promise<Action>

Parameters#

NameTypeDefault value
variablesMutationDeclineSpaceMembershipRequestArgsundefined
fieldsActionFields'basic'
accessToken?stringundefined

Returns#

Promise<Action>

Defined in#

packages/client/src/clients/spaceMembership.client.ts:84


getMemberRequests#

getMemberRequests(variables, fields?, accessToken?): Promise<SpaceJoinRequest[]>

Parameters#

NameTypeDefault value
variablesQueryMemberSpaceMembershipRequestArgsundefined
fieldsSpaceJoinRequestFields'basic'
accessToken?stringundefined

Returns#

Promise<SpaceJoinRequest[]>

Defined in#

packages/client/src/clients/spaceMembership.client.ts:28


getRequests#

getRequests(variables, fields?, accessToken?): Promise<SpaceJoinRequest[]>

Parameters#

NameTypeDefault value
variablesQuerySpaceMembershipRequestsArgsundefined
fieldsSpaceJoinRequestFields'basic'
accessToken?stringundefined

Returns#

Promise<SpaceJoinRequest[]>

Defined in#

packages/client/src/clients/spaceMembership.client.ts:42


request#

request(variables, fields?, accessToken?): Promise<SpaceJoinRequest>

Parameters#

NameTypeDefault value
variablesMutationRequestSpaceMembershipArgsundefined
fieldsSpaceJoinRequestFields'basic'
accessToken?stringundefined

Returns#

Promise<SpaceJoinRequest>

Defined in#

packages/client/src/clients/spaceMembership.client.ts:56